Custom Block 1.0.0

Custom Block 1.0.0

Хак позволяет добавить новый параметр для тега custom block, который при значении yes будет брать специальный *.tpl файл. В этом файле можно задать оформление, если есть новости в выводимом custom или нет.


Плагин берёт следующий custom_block_название.tpl файл, который нужно самому создать при использовании параметра block="yes". Пример вывода, когда плагин возьмет следующий файл custom_block_shortstory.tpl в папке вашего шаблона:
{custom id="1" block="yes" template="shortstory" cache="no"}

Внутри TPL файла доступны теги:
  1. [news] ... [/news] - выведет любой текст внутри если у custom есть новости.
  2. {news} - выведет сами новости.
  3. [not-news] ... [/not-news] - выведет любой текст внутри если у custom нет новостей.

При использовании этого примера, плагин возьмет следующий файл custom_block_custom1.tpl в папке вашего шаблона:
{custom id="2" block="yes" template="dir/custom1" cache="no"}

custom-block-1_0_0.zip
Создайте аккаунт или авторизуйтесь для скачивания

custom-block-1_0_0-15_2.zip
Создайте аккаунт или авторизуйтесь для скачивания

custom-block-1_0_0-15_3.zip
Создайте аккаунт или авторизуйтесь для скачивания
 
Версия DLE: 13.х-14.1, 15.2, 15.3
Кодировка: utf-8
Автор: LazyDev
Источник

Примечание от Oxigen: добавлен дистрибутив с поддержкой DLE 15.3

Информация
Посетители, находящиеся в группе Гость, не могут оставлять комментарии к данной публикации.